Description
This is a pair of gate piers and gates located approximately 140 metres north-northwest of Waddeton Court, dating from around the mid-19th century. They are constructed from local limestone ashlar and are square in shape, featuring stepped pyramid caps topped with griffons. The entrance is completed with wrought iron double gates.
